Comparing the efficacy of different treatments in psychiatry is difficult for many
reasons, even when they are investigated in `head-to-head' studies. A consensus
meeting was, therefore, held to produce best practice guidelines for such studies.
This article presents the conclusions of this consensus and illustrates it using
published data in the field of antidepressant treatment of generalized anxiety
disorder.
